Webb2 nov. 2024 · Many meat processors routinely inject meats like turkey, chicken, and pork at the factory. Injecting, or enhancing as food processors call it, is a sure fire way to get the flavor and juiciness down deep. And it is the only way to get fats, herbs, spices and other large molecules deep into meat.

Webb5 mars 2024 · Injecting meat with acidic ingredients like vinegar, wine or lemon juice helps tenderize the meat and partially cook it. This means your meat may cook more quickly, and you’ll need to carefully follow the cooking instructions when using acidic based ingredients with your flavor injector.
